    Often after running, I sit at the base of the Jeptha Wade (1811-1890) obelisk (red star!) and write/blog using my cellular phone as the wireless modem for my laptop.  I just realized yesterday that Wade was the founder of Western Union and, of course, it was a Western Union internal memo in 1876 that predicted; "This 'telephone' has too many short comings to be seriously considered as a means of communication. This device is inherently of no value to us."  heh
